1. Topographic Maps

Topographic maps represent the three-dimensional terrain of an area on a two-dimensional surface. They use contour lines to show elevation changes, providing crucial information about the steepness and shape of the land. Understanding map symbols and contour lines is fundamental.

Key Map Features:

Practical Example: Reading Contour Lines

Imagine two peaks on a map. Peak A has closely spaced contour lines, while Peak B has widely spaced contour lines. This indicates that Peak A is steeper than Peak B. If the contour interval is 40 feet (12 meters) and Peak A has 10 contour lines, its vertical rise is 400 feet (120 meters) from the base. Practice identifying terrain features like valleys, ridges, saddles, and spurs using contour lines.

2. The Compass

A compass is an indispensable tool for determining direction. Understanding its components and how to use them effectively is essential for navigating in the mountains. There are different types of compasses, but the baseplate compass is most commonly used for land navigation.

Taking a Bearing

A bearing is the angle between a line of sight to a distant object and magnetic north. Here's how to take a bearing:

  1. Point the direction-of-travel arrow on the baseplate towards the object you want to take a bearing on.
  2. Hold the compass level in front of you.
  3. Rotate the compass housing until the orienting arrow aligns with the north end of the magnetic needle. Make sure the red (north) end of the needle points towards the orienting arrow.
  4. Read the bearing at the index line on the baseplate.

Practical Example: Navigating in Fog

Imagine you're hiking in the Scottish Highlands and dense fog rolls in. You can't see the trail markers, but you know the bearing to your next checkpoint is 90 degrees (East). Using your compass, maintain a bearing of 90 degrees, carefully monitoring your surroundings and using your map to anticipate terrain changes. This allows you to continue navigating safely even in zero visibility.

1. Orienting the Map

Orienting the map involves aligning it with the terrain, so that features on the map correspond to features on the ground. This allows you to visualize your location and the surrounding landscape more accurately.

Steps to Orient the Map:

  1. Identify a prominent feature on the map, such as a peak, a lake, or a road.
  2. Locate the same feature on the ground.
  3. Rotate the map until the feature on the map aligns with the feature on the ground.

Alternatively, use your compass to orient the map by aligning the north arrow on the map with the north end of the magnetic needle on your compass. Remember to account for magnetic declination (explained later).

2. Resection

Resection is a technique used to determine your location on the map by taking bearings to two or more known landmarks.

Steps to Resect:

  1. Identify two or three prominent landmarks that are visible on the ground and identifiable on the map.
  2. Take a bearing to each landmark using your compass.
  3. Convert the magnetic bearings to true bearings by adding or subtracting the magnetic declination (explained later).
  4. Draw a line on the map from each landmark along the back bearing (the opposite direction of the bearing you took). For example, if the bearing to a landmark is 45 degrees, the back bearing is 225 degrees.
  5. The point where the lines intersect is your approximate location on the map.

3. Following a Bearing

Following a bearing involves navigating in a straight line using your compass. This is useful for traveling through featureless terrain or when visibility is limited.

Steps to Follow a Bearing:

  1. Determine the bearing you want to follow.
  2. Hold your compass level in front of you.
  3. Rotate the compass housing until the orienting arrow aligns with the north end of the magnetic needle.
  4. Choose a landmark in the direction of your bearing.
  5. Walk towards the landmark, keeping the compass aligned with the magnetic needle.
  6. Repeat the process, choosing new landmarks as you move forward.

5. Understanding Magnetic Declination

Magnetic declination is the angle between true north (the geographic North Pole) and magnetic north (the direction your compass needle points). The declination varies depending on your location on Earth. It's important to account for declination when taking bearings or transferring bearings from the map to the ground.

Finding the Declination

The magnetic declination for your area is usually indicated on the topographic map. You can also find it online using declination calculators or websites.
